Default Adu reiterates Real desire

Quote:
Freddy Adu has reiterated his desire to play for Real Madrid as he begins pre-season training with Real Salt Lake at the Spanish club's training complex.

The 17-year-old is preparing for the forthcoming campaign with his new Major League Soccer side, but is still thinking about a move to Europe.

After impressing during a two-week trial at Manchester United, the American starlet will have a window to prove himself while in Madrid.

Real Salt Lake are due to play a Madrid Select XI in a friendly and Adu is hoping he can catch the eye to lay the foundations for a move to the Bernabeu.

"My desire to come here still stands," Adu said. "Look at the situation I'm in, I play for 'Real' Salt Lake now, so you never know, right?

"Maybe one day, Real Madrid's going to come knocking. We'll see what happens."

Looking ahead to the friendly against the Real Madrid side, Adu is relishing the chance to test his abilities against the Spanish giants.

"I'm definitely looking forward to it," he continued. "It's always a challenge to play against any Real Madrid team.

"I'm young and I know most of those guys are going to be young too. I'd like to compare where I stand to most of them because they play for one of the biggest clubs in the world. It will be a fun experience."

Adu was traded by DC United to Real Salt Lake in December, a move the Ghana-born attacker revealed he wanted.

"I couldn't be happier," he added. "Not a lot of people know this, but it was something I wanted.

"I tried out with Manchester United for two weeks and then made the decision to join a team where I could play in my natural position.

"I'm an attacking midfielder and I knew this team was going to give me an opportunity to play in that position.

"I have a good relationship with coach [John] Ellinger and I asked to be traded to Real Salt Lake."

Considering the rumours are he failed his United trial I wouldn't think any top club would make a proper move for him until he's proven.

Then again his marketing potential is huge and while Real are trying to get away from their "Galacticos" but it's a lot of money and it must be difficult for them to resist.

I don't know what La Liga team would be best for Adu. A move to Real Madrid would mean that he would have to be prepared not to be a regular for 3 seasons.

But I think Adu has his sights set on joining a big team (Real Madrid, Manchester United) rather than joining a good european side like Zaragoza or Atletico Madrid and then proving how good he is in europe.
